DEATHS.

MACKIE—On Saturday, May 10, 1919, at his daughter's residence, Waiwlrl Bond, Toko, William Mackle, beloved husband of the late Annie Mackle; aged SIS. CANNON—At Private Hospital, on May 10, Eleanor Londgon Cannon, dearly beloved wife of William Cannon, Stratford; aged 44 years. CLARK.—At New Plymouth, on May 10, 1919, Joseph Clark, of Okato; aged 76 years. BARRETT. —On May 10, at Brown Street, New Plymouth, Catherine Barrett, aged 89 years. Private Interment. (Auckland and Chrlstchurch papers please copy.) M. E. CLOW, Undertaker.
